The September edition of Kodansha‘s Monthly Dessert revealed a new spinoff is brewing for Megumi Morino‘s heart-tugging romance A Condition Called Love. This fresh take sprouts in the January issue.
Like a school bell signaling the end of class, the main story concluded in the July 24 issue after its 2017 debut. Morino’s emotional rollercoaster has enchanted over 4 million readers worldwide, earning the 2021 Kodansha Manga Award for Best Shōjo title. Volume 17 hit shelves May 13.
Across the ocean, Kodansha USA Publishing brought the digital version stateside in 2020, with physical copies blossoming in January 2023. Volume 16 debuted April 8, continuing the tale of Hotaru – a girl who traded umbrella chivalry for romantic whirlwinds when she rescued heartbroken Hananoi that snowy day.
High schooler Hotaru never chased love like her peers, content with family and friendship’s warm glow. But destiny laughed when her simple kindness – sharing an umbrella with dumped classmate Hananoi – triggered a classroom confession that would rewrite her life’s script.
The story unfolded in animated glory this April 2024, with Crunchyroll delivering each episode worldwide.
